Output c3717f07a194d742629c15574f94d7c93eff31f60906c685d7a953626b8941e6:45

value
14756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 383de4b78686c03b76c07494e1c93897f17bb5f7 OP_EQUAL
address
36pPuiXiYVr2uoGaQZDYArTpnTCJNQq51n
transaction
c3717f07a194d742629c15574f94d7c93eff31f60906c685d7a953626b8941e6
confirmations
254981
spent
true